repercussion
词根词缀:
concussion n. 冲击;震荡
con 加强 + cuss 摇动 + ion 表名词 → 摇动得厉害 → 震荡
discuss v. 讨论
dis 分散 + cuss 摇动 → 分散敲击〔问题〕→ 讨论
percussion n. 震动
per 加强 + cuss 摇动 + ion 表名词 → 猛烈摇动 → 震动
repercussion n. 反响;回响
re 回 + percussion 震动 → 震动回来的余震 → 反响;回响
